Aristotle considered Oedipus Tyrannus the supreme example of tragic drama and modeled his theory of tragedy on it. He mentions the play no fewer than eleven times in his De poetica (c. 334-323 b.c.e.; Poetics, 1705). The sentry in Antigone is a messenger who clearly has no desire to tell his tale. The entire seventeen lines of the sentry’s opening speech, in which he must report Polynices’ burial to Creon, are devoted to trying not to speak.
